Extended Stay America Suites - Orlando - Maitland - Summit Tower Blvd

Orlando|2.1km from Walgreens
Review: Extended Stay America 1951 Summit Tower Blvd Orlando (Maitland) FL 32810 General Manager Isabel Munoz We stayed here for 7 nights in March 2022 Location: Firstly, don't confuse this review with two other very nearby ESA hotels. Although the same brand, they can be quite different. Just north of Orlando, away from the ”attractions”, but very close to center city and the northern residential communities. Fast food restaurants across the street. Grocery within a mile. Other shopping within a couple of miles. The neighborhood is primarily upscale office buildings and residential; well lighted, quiet. We felt very safe here. Not much evidence of nearby public transportation. Outstanding health club complex (pools, ice rinks, basketball, tennis, pickleball, training) a short walk away, but pricey. The Hotel is older, and a bit on the ”budget” side (no ice machine, minimal free breakfast, no USB ports in the room), BUT... ...it's very well maintained. Our room and hallway were clearly recently refurbished, with fresh carpet and flooring, new paint on the walls (very professionally done), and everything works. We had a single queen suite, with kitchenette, dinette/desk, lounge chair, and isolated vanity and tub/shower. The exterior windows actually opened, the AC was quiet and powerful. Everything was clean. A coin-op laundry is on the 2nd floor, all machines worked. Internet basic was free, pay for upgrade (we used our Hotspot instead, 4 bars). Other features (that we didn't use): Outdoor pool, treadmills. Staff was friendly and responsive. We asked for and received basic cooking utensils; sometimes the room key card didn't work, but they were apologetic and quickly remedied the problem. Summary: this is a basic, but exceptionally well maintained hotel in a quiet neighborhood. My compliments to the Manager and Staff. We tipped them generously.

Marriott Orlando Downtown
4/5105 Reviews
Orlando Downtown
My first impression of this property was very favorable. This is obviously an older Marriott property that has undergone a really nice refurbishment. Everything is updated from the lobby to the rooms to the M Club. I am a Bonvoy Platinum elite. I checked in on the mobile app and was pleasantly surprised that I was checked in promptly, however none of my room requests were met. High floor away from elevator are my preferences. High floor isn't a big deal but I was placed in a room directly adjacent to the elevator with no platinum upgrade. The room was very nice and updated and I was really happy with how well they had updated the rooms. My main gripe with this property was the poorly managed M Club with embarrassing food options. The breakfast was adequate and in line with most other M Clubs, however the evening hors d'oeuvres were embarrassing. On the Saturday evening of my stay the evening hors d'oeuvres were put out an hour late and when they finally were put out, the offering was frozen chicken strips (think kids meal at a restaurant) that were cold and the worst hard waffles that were obviously left over from breakfast (they serve the same waffles at breakfast). They were hard and cold. The person who set up the hors d'oeuvres didn't put out ANY serving utensils for any of the offerings. They also had very small platters of cheese, crackers and meats. There were so few crackers put out that they were gone in a minute. The person who set up the food went back to the front desk and never returned. The one other embarrassing miss for Marriot and their M Clubs is that they require guests to pay for drinks in the M Club. What a blow to their most loyal guests. Other competing brands offer complimentary evening happy hours. Overall this is a decent property, but they really need to step up their evening hors d'oeuvres game.
